Forever Again Fairfax, Virginia

Forever Again is an American Indie rock band based in the Washington DC area. Beginning as the casual solo project of Chris Wetterman, the duo officially formed when Wetterman joined with vocalist Christian Nuckels to play guitar for Nuckels' solo album, Alive and Free.
